The Team
We are three Information Technology students from OsloMet who all really enjoy developing and are passionate about what we are building.
Meet the Team
Our Approach
Careful planning
We used MoSCoW prioritization to categorize features as Must-have, Should-have, Could-have, or Won't-have, focusing on critical functionality first. Our planning included UML diagrams, database modeling, risk assessments, and wireframes validated through user testing before development.
Scrum
We implemented Scrum practices with two-week sprints, daily stand-ups, and regular retrospectives to maintain alignment and consistent progress throughout the project.
Quality Focus
Our testing strategy included unit tests for all server actions and end-to-end testing for critical user flows, ensuring reliable and maintainable code.
CI/CD for continuous feedback
We established a robust CI/CD pipeline connected to our GitHub repository, automatically deploying updates to a hosted demo environment. This approach allowed us to catch deployment issues early while providing stakeholders with 24/7 access to test new features and provide ongoing feedback throughout development.
Exceeding expectations
Our final delivery surpassed the original project vision. We successfully implemented all Must-have and Should-have requirements as planned for our MVP, allowing time for additional refinements and quality improvements that elevated the user experience beyond initial expectations.